The first step toward understanding surge protectors for international purposes is knowing what a surge is. Voltage surges are caused by different phenomena like lightning strikes, grid-switching activities, and the operation of heavy electrical devices. Thus, a good surge protector would protect sensitive equipment against possible damage caused by such unexpected surges. For this reason, surge protectors must be designed to accommodate different plug types and voltage levels around the globe. The presence of a single plug for surge protection is beneficial as it attains versatility and ease of use. This kind of surge protector is nice in letting an individual connect their devices regardless of plug type. It serves the purpose fine for travelers and expatriates who need something adaptable to different electrical environments. Additionally, choosing a surge protector according to the joule ratings is of prime importance as this indicates how much energy is absorbed by the surge protector before failing, thus safeguarding electronic gadgets during voltage transients. Furthermore, it would be worth checking whether the protector has indicator lights showing proper functioning and USB ports to charge several products simultaneously. For global buyers, safety standards and certifications are vital when it comes to the purchase of a surge protector plug. Various regions have different requirements for safety, and compliance with regulations makes a product reliable and safe to consumer use. Buyers should familiarize themselves with certifications like UL (Underwriters Laboratories), CE (Conformité Européenne), and RoHS (Restriction of Hazardous Substances), each of which indicates that a surge protector conforms to stringent safety standards and environmental requirements.
Further, standards of safety cannot be stressed enough in working towards protecting valuable electronics against unpredicted electrical surges. A surge protector that fulfills the highest safety criteria protects connected devices from damage as much as possible and reduces the chance of fire. Buyers in all regions must, therefore, look out for products with full certification information confirming very stringent testing with compliance with local and international safety standards. Choosing surge protectors, customers will always find it hard to decide whether to go for a standalone surge protector plug or a power strip solution. Each alternative has its perks attached to various needs and environments. A standalone surge protector plug suits consumers who want a slim and efficient way to protect individual devices, but often have to deal with inadequate space. The plugs are often travel-ready and would be suitable for overseas shoppers who are looking to safeguard their devices on the go; without the inconvenience of unnecessary bulk.
Power strip solutions have given a port multi-unit hookup option, allowing more than one gadget to be connected at the same time to their respective protection against intruding power surges. Mostly, homes or offices would benefit from this kind of arrangement since several gadgets located in a room would often need to be protected by the power strip. Power strips further prove to be very useful in a consumeristic setup by coming along with certain features like inbuilt circuit breaker and several ports such as USB ones. However, the simple yet portable single surge protector plug becomes the more important option for anyone needing travel versatility and protection on the light side.
Thus, while single surge protector plugs do provide the missing dimensions of portability and protection to individual devices, they are not the best solution for many stationary setups, particularly with a larger number of plugged devices. Knowing the difference between the two would serve any international buyer in picking the right one, depending on the specific requirements.
